garçon Posted October 1, 2020 at 11:31 PM Posted October 1, 2020 at 11:31 PM So, the lambs are here in this video haha https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=IStG32mZejI I was just about to post the same video here.I hope this contextualisation of the nasty and unnecessary comments by Mariah gets picked up by many people. We all know Celine was invited by Aretha to duet with her, just after Mariah had let her down. Obviously Mariah was very jealous of Celine. I have no other word for it. Just to set the record straight, not everyone knows perhaps: Aretha didn’t rehearse the show. By surprise she started to dominate the last two songs (Natural Woman and Testimony), diminishing all the head liners to stage props for more than 10 minutes during the second song. So, that was totally unscripted and awkward. FYI: on the official videorelease Testimony was edited, they cut a large part of it. Also, Aretha’s solo songs were cut from the audio release to compensate. It was not rude or inappropriate at all of Celine to take a short moment with Aretha; following her.Also vocally at that very moment. Mariah should not have projected her insecurities on Celine. 1 Quote
